My initial foray into the world of portable workspaces involved a simple, featherlight model, height adjustable with uncanny precision. Uneven surfaces? Ancient history. No more hunching over mismatched café tables or wrestling with rickety surfaces. This adaptable marvel – think of it as a workspace shapeshifter – adjusted effortlessly to the contours of park benches and five-star hotel suites alike.

But true alchemy emerged with the bespoke customization. A premium laptop riser drastically improved ergonomics, achieving optimal screen positioning and banishing neck and wrist strain. A compact, secondary monitor dramatically expanded my digital canvas, revolutionizing my workflow. The final flourish? An external keyboard and mouse, transforming my mobile setup into a miniature, high-octane productivity powerhouse.

Cable chaos, a common foe of digital nomads, met its match. Maintaining order amidst a whirlwind of travel became paramount. Small cable wranglers and zip ties kept everything neatly corralled, even during frantic packing sprees. This once-unimaginable level of organization is now the bedrock of my sanity and creative flow, allowing me to maintain peak productivity on the move.

Ambient illumination? Crucial. The relentless assault of direct sunlight is a productivity killer, inducing eye strain and screen glare akin to a medieval torture device. Conversely, working in a dimly lit crypt breeds fatigue and throbbing headaches. Therefore, I religiously seek locations bathed in soft, natural light—or cleverly deploy my adjustable travel lamp. This meticulous attention to light fosters sustained concentration and holistic well-being; a principle as immutable as the law of cause and effect. Frequently Asked Questions

What type of travel table is best for remote work?

It depends on your individual needs and preferences. Consider factors like weight, adjustability, portability, and sturdiness when making your decision.

How do I stay productive while working remotely and traveling?

Establish a routine, set clear goals, utilize time management techniques, and minimize distractions. Prioritize creating a comfortable and ergonomic workspace wherever you go.

What are the best accessories to complement a travel table?

A good laptop stand, external monitor, keyboard, mouse, cable organizers, and a comfortable chair can greatly enhance your remote work experience.
